Stoke, Harecastle Tunnel, and the Macclesfield Canal

When we left our moorings at Barlaston the weather was surprisingly cloudy, cool and breezy.  Fortunately in an hour or so the sun had emerged and temperatures rose.

We cruised north through Stoke on Trent reaching Westport Lake where we often moor.  Since it was only lunchtime we decided to eat on the move and travel onwards to the 1.75 mile Harecastle Tunnel where we had a half hour wait before we were allowed in - there is no room for boats to pass.  It took us a reasonable 40 minutes to reach the other end at Kidsgrove.  Here we turned off the Trent & Mersey Canal onto the Macclesfield Canal, the main objective of our journey.  We have moored about half a mile from Tesco which will provide the only opportunity to shop for a couple of days.
